In Search of Mah Hang
During the era of Chinese exclusion, a Canadian-born Chinese woman dared to challenge tradition and power. In 1931, Mah Hang confronted the male-dominated Wong Clan Association in a courageous attempt to free herself and her children from an arranged marriage to a much older man.
Directed by Victoria So. Produced by Catherine Clement and Dr. Henry Yu.
23 minutes.
Born an Immigrant – The Dressmaker
An uplifting documentary about a Canadian-born Chinese woman who supports her family by becoming a dressmaker in Victoria, British Columbia during the Chinese Exclusion Act.
